Fort Wayne's Investor-Friendly Market Fundamentals

Fort Wayne's real estate market offers several compelling advantages for those considering flipping houses for beginners in Fort Wayne. The city boasts a median home price significantly below the national average, typically ranging from $130,000 to $180,000, which creates more accessible entry points for new investors. This lower barrier to entry means your first time fix and flip loan in Fort Wayne won't require the massive capital commitments seen in coastal markets.

The local economy, anchored by manufacturing, healthcare, and education sectors, provides stability that translates into consistent housing demand. Major employers like Parkview Health System, General Motors, and multiple universities ensure a steady population base that supports both rental and resale markets.

What Are Fix and Flip Loans?

Fix and flip loans, also known as hard money loans, are short-term financing solutions specifically designed for real estate investors who purchase properties, renovate them, and sell them quickly for profit. Unlike traditional mortgages that can take 30-45 days to close, a first time fix and flip loan Fort Wayne can typically close within 7-14 days, giving investors the speed necessary to secure profitable deals in competitive markets.

These loans are asset-based, meaning lenders focus primarily on the property's value and profit potential rather than the borrower's credit score or income history. This makes hard money for new investors Fort Wayne IN particularly attractive for beginners who may not yet have extensive financial documentation or perfect credit.

How Fix and Flip Loans Work

The process begins when you identify a potential flip property in Fort Wayne. After conducting your due diligence and determining the after-repair value (ARV), you can apply for financing that typically covers 70-90% of the purchase price plus renovation costs. Here's how the typical process unfolds:

Initial Funding: Upon closing, you receive funds to purchase the property. Many lenders will also provide a renovation budget based on detailed contractor estimates and scope of work.

Renovation Phase: As you complete renovation milestones, the lender releases funds from the construction budget. This draw system ensures money is available when needed while protecting the lender's investment.

Exit Strategy: Once renovations are complete, you sell the property and use proceeds to repay the loan, keeping the profit difference.

Understanding the Costs

While fix and flip loans provide accessibility and speed, they typically carry higher interest rates than traditional mortgages – usually ranging from 8-15% annually. However, since these are short-term loans (typically 6-18 months), the total interest paid is often reasonable when compared to the profit potential of a successful flip.

Most lenders also charge origination fees (1-5% of loan amount) and may require interest-only payments during the renovation period, improving cash flow for active projects.

Step 1: Assess Your Financial Readiness

Before diving into flipping houses for beginners Fort Wayne, evaluate your financial position honestly. Most lenders require a minimum credit score of 620-680 and proof of liquid assets covering at least 20-30% of the project cost. Calculate your debt-to-income ratio and gather documentation of your income sources, bank statements, and any existing real estate investments.

Underestimating Renovation Costs and Timelines

One of the most frequent errors among those flipping houses for beginners Fort Wayne is severely underestimating both the cost and time required for renovations. Fort Wayne's older housing stock, particularly in neighborhoods like West Central and Lakeside, often presents unexpected challenges such as outdated electrical systems, plumbing issues, or foundation problems.

To avoid this mistake, always add a 20-30% buffer to your renovation budget and timeline. Conduct thorough inspections before purchasing, and consider hiring experienced local contractors who understand Fort Wayne's building codes and permit requirements.
